Lebanese President Aoun Says Threat of War Over, Urges Timely Elections

Lebanese President  Joseph  Aoun said on Thursday that the threat of war in Lebanon has been removed and expressed optimism about the country’s positive trajectory.

Speaking after a meeting with Maronite Patriarch Cardinal Bechara Boutros Al-Rai, Aoun said: “I extend my greetings to all Lebanese, and God willing, next year we will witness the birth of a new Lebanon and a state of accountability… a state of institutions, not of parties and sects.”

He added that “there is a bleeding wound in the south” and hoped that the birth of a new Lebanon would end conflicts and bring peace. Aoun emphasized: “President Nabih Berri, President Nawaf Salam, and I are determined to hold elections on time, which is a constitutional requirement.”
